Discharge Notice

Your physician will write an order on your medical record indicating the day of your discharge. You are not charged for the room the day you go home. Usually financial arrangements will have been made before you are discharged. If not, you or a member of your family will be requested to go to the Medical Center’s Business Office, which is located adjacent to the main lobby on the first floor, near the main entrance.

When appropriate financial arrangements have been made, the financial counselor in the Business Office will sign your “Discharge Notice”. Present the signed “Discharge Notice” to the nurses on your unit and you will be ready to go home. Your nurse will help you reclaim your valuables.
